Output 3bddd7eda94200021b453dd158e5ad6b4943effb20f1a95f8d734a32056a7225:20

value
446496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c711c2c0a44c3e17b8e8d99afdd40ce10df664 OP_EQUAL
address
39EhoreEJWAFf8gzNZT9Gp2zcv8R1Xm8DW
transaction
3bddd7eda94200021b453dd158e5ad6b4943effb20f1a95f8d734a32056a7225
spent
true